Frequently asked questions

How many properties are there on Forest Way, Ayr?
12 properties have been assessed for an Energy Performance Certificate on Forest Way since 2008, across 1 postcode (KA7 3ST). A home that has never needed an EPC will not appear.
What type of homes are on Forest Way?
The most common recorded type on Forest Way is "Bungalow" (10 of 12 properties), and the median recorded floor area is 102 m². The most common energy rating is band D.
What did a property on Forest Way last sell for?
Scotland's individual sale records are held by Registers of Scotland rather than published as open data, so this page cannot list sold prices. Their free ScotLIS service shows what any address on Forest Way last sold for, and local price trends are on our KA7 district page.

About this data

Every property on this page comes from the Scottish Energy Performance Certificate register: homes assessed since 2008, each shown with its latest certificate's type, construction age band, floor area and energy rating. A home that has never been sold, let or newly built since 2008 may not have a certificate and will not appear. Scotland does not publish individual sold prices as open data — check any address free on ScotLIS. Contains public sector information licensed under the Open Government Licence v3.0.
